Palm tree is a standard title of perennial lianas, shrubs, and trees. They may be the only real members of the family Arecaceae, which can be the sole family from the order Arecales. They increase in scorching climates.

Pritchardia affinis, a critically endangered species endemic towards the Hawaiian Islands Some palms are in peril of dying out as a result of human action. The best risks are from substantial towns, mining, and turning forests into farmland.

The Majesty Palm is usually a graceful, elegant palm with long, arching fronds plus a straight, slender trunk. It might arrive at amazing heights outdoor—approximately forty toes—but when developed indoors, it usually stays all around six to 10 feet tall. Its lush foliage and tropical vibe enable it to be a favorite for inside landscaping.

The Coconut Palm can be an iconic tropical tree recognized for its tall, slender trunk and enormous, arching fronds. It's the tree that makes coconuts, with experienced palms reaching around sixty–a hundred feet in top. Its putting silhouette is a well-recognized sight on tropical shorelines and coastal landscapes.

A methane capture facility installed at palm oil mills harnesses methane fuel from POME treatment method. The methane gas is then used to electricity mills, estates, and staff’ housing.

The California admirer palm is really a medium-sized ornamental palm tree with lengthy, lover-shaped fronds with fibrous threads and a durable columnar trunk. The identifying feature with the California enthusiast palm is its amazing leaves manufactured up of waxy green blades that spread out inside of a enthusiast condition.
